The Clipper, 1936

 The Clipper, 1936, at the Los Angeles Museum of Modern Art

The accompanying note dubs this an "airplane without wings", and says Wally Byam was taking advantage of the burgeoning aircraft industry in Los Angeles which enabled him to hire skilled craftsmen.  This was named after the Pan Am Clipper.
